CEO and General Manager, TECNASA Group
Bio
Gaby Aued is CEO of TECNASA Group, a Central American high-tech conglomerate based in Panama. She became part of the company in 2000, and developed her career in different positions including operations supervisor, financial solutions manager, and regional product manager. In 2002, she opened TECNASA operations in El Salvador and served as General Manager from 2006 until 2011. Prior to joining TECNASA she worked in a licensed international communications consultancy in New York. She is a Fellow of the Aspen Institute and a member of the Central America Leadership Initiative (CALI).
It was a challenging year for the country and its socio-economic status in the region. TECNASA is a company that has been able to diversify its risks by expanding geographically. So, when one country in the region faces economic difficulties, we have other geographic locations that are able to grow and compensate for it. We are a company that has consistently been growing throughout our 45 years of history. Our market share depends on the service and solutions we provide. One of our most important solutions throughout the region are the financial solutions and ATM’s, especially in Panama where we cover over 80% of the market. We also have over 2,000 clients in the region that are the most important companies in each their respective industries. We are a business-to-business company focused on mid to large-sized enterprises.
Our vision has always been to become a regional leader in IT solution integrations. In 2017, we analyzed that TECNASA has become the IT solutions leader in Central America and Ecuador. After more than two years of planning, we launched our new strategy in 2017, which is focused on managed services. It is not a strategy based on geographic expansion but on improving the quality of our services and transforming our portfolio from the hardware sales to service solution implementation. Our strategy is also based on becoming consultants for our clients and helping them understand the new disruptive technologies present in the market and how it can help them improve their business operations.
